So how was this 74ls189 chip used? The 74ls189 is a 64-bit RAM organized as 16 words of 4 bits each. Its primary function is to store and retrieve digital information quickly. Each of the 16 memory locations can be individually addressed using four address lines. Data is written into or read from a selected location based on the state of the write enable and output enable pins. Key features are captured in the following list:

  • 64-bit RAM (16 x 4 organization)
  • Open-collector outputs, allowing for wired-OR configurations
  • Typical access time of around 35 nanoseconds

Historically, the 74ls189 found use in various applications, including:

  1. Small memory buffers in digital systems
  2. Lookup tables
  3. Control memory for microprocessors
